What Safety Features Should Be Included in a Quality 50 Amp to 30 Amp RV Adapter?

The safety features in a quality 50 Amp to 30 Amp RV adapter are crucial for ensuring safe and reliable electrical connections.

  • Built-in Circuit Breaker: A circuit breaker is essential for protecting against overloads and short circuits. If the electrical current exceeds safe limits, the breaker will trip, cutting off power and preventing potential damage to your RV’s electrical system.
  • Heavy-Duty Construction: The adapter should be made from high-quality, durable materials that can withstand harsh outdoor conditions. This ensures that the adapter can handle the rigors of travel and frequent use without compromising safety.
  • Weatherproof Design: A weatherproof design is important to prevent moisture and dust from entering the adapter. This feature enhances safety by reducing the risk of electrical shorts and corrosion, which can occur in adverse weather conditions.
  • LED Power Indicator: An LED power indicator provides a visual confirmation that power is flowing through the adapter. This feature helps users quickly identify whether the connection is active, reducing the risk of accidental disconnection while using appliances.
  • High-Quality Connectors: The connectors should be made of high-quality materials, such as copper or brass, to ensure a secure and efficient connection. Poor-quality connectors can lead to overheating and increased resistance, which poses safety risks.
  • Overheat Protection: Some adapters come with overheat protection features that can automatically shut off power if the adapter becomes too hot. This safety measure helps to prevent fires and further electrical hazards.
  • Compliance with Electrical Standards: It’s important that the adapter meets relevant electrical safety standards, such as UL or ETL certification. Compliance ensures that the product has undergone rigorous testing for safety and performance, providing peace of mind to users.

How Can You Choose the Best 50 Amp to 30 Amp RV Adapter for Your Needs?

Choosing the best 50 amp to 30 amp RV adapter involves considering several key factors to ensure compatibility and safety.

  • Wattage Rating: It’s crucial to select an adapter that can handle the wattage demands of your RV. A good adapter should have a wattage rating above what your RV will draw to avoid overheating and potential damage.
  • Build Quality: Look for adapters made from durable materials, preferably with heavy-duty connectors. A sturdy design can withstand outdoor conditions and frequent use without breaking down.
  • Length of Cable: The length of the adapter cable can affect versatility and ease of use. Longer cables allow for greater flexibility in positioning your RV, but ensure they are stowed properly to avoid tripping hazards.
  • Compatibility: Ensure the adapter is compatible with your specific RV model and electrical system. Some RVs may have unique wiring configurations that necessitate specific adapters.
  • Safety Features: Look for adapters equipped with safety features such as surge protection and LED indicators. These features can prevent electrical mishaps and provide peace of mind during use.
  • Brand Reputation: Consider purchasing from reputable brands known for their electrical products. Established brands often provide better customer support and warranty options, which can be invaluable in case of defects or issues.
  • Price: While cost should not be the only factor, it’s important to find an adapter that balances quality and price. Investing in a slightly more expensive adapter can save you from future headaches related to poor performance or safety issues.
